    Product Features and Details
    HO Scale AC Era VI Includes a digital decoder Includes a sound effect 

    Alternating current Digital PremiumIntegrated locomotive soundWith interior lightingThe model has a coupler pocket and short coupling cinematicLength over buffer in mmNavigable minimum radius 360 mm21-pole electrical interface, newLocomotive has flywheel driveTriple headlights and two red taillights alternating with the direction of travel

    Model Details:

    • Separately mounted handrails
    • Finely detailed, three-dimensional bogie
    • Finest paintwork and printing
    • True-to-scale fan-grill
    • True-to-scale engravings and details
    • Close-coupling
    • All axles driven
    • LED lighting
    • 21-pole interface
    • Driver's cab light and red tail lights can be switched on and off
    • Filigree electonic coupling
    • Functional, switchable fan
    • Different light signals switchable
    • BRAWA Gravita-Sound
    • Switchable high beam

    Prototype: Although the vehicle had only existed as a prototype andwas not yet widely tested, DB Schenker decided on morethan 130 locomotives for the Gravita 10 BB in its 2007 bid invitation. By now, the first units of the Gravita 10 BB are in use on the Northrail on German rail tracks. The designated DB machines are currently in production and will soon be seen in use nationwide under the series designation BR 260. Apart from Northrail, another 5 locomotives went to Switzerland. Continuing this success, the next larger sister in this series, the Gravita 15 BB, was shown in Berlin in 2010. Although only 1.2 m longer than the Gravita 10 BB, it produces up to 1,800kW, making it as suitable for line service as it is for shunting. All locomotives built by Voith Turbo Lokomotivtechnik are also suited for multi-led traction with each other. The engine assembled under the serial number L04-15 001 is being exhaustively tested at present.
